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: Sublime Text 2, установка  (Прочитано 4799 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н slo_nik

  • Автор темы
  • Активист
  • *
  • Сообщений: 489
    • Просмотр профиля
Sublime Text 2, установка
« : 21 Апреля 2013, 20:23:37 »
Добрый вечер
Помогите разобраться с Sublime Text 2.
Решил попробовать указанный редактор, скачал с сайта архив tar.bz2
Распаковал, в папке нет файлов "Install" или "Readme" или чего-то подобного, есть "sublime_text".
Запустил, всё работает.
Вопрос в следующем, куда переместить указанную папку с редактором, в "/opt" и нужно ли это делать? Не хотелось бы, чтобы он мешался в домашней директории.
Или лучше скачать с указанного сайта deb пакет и установить из него редактор?
Есть ещё вариант с подключением репозитория и установить редактор оттуда.
Какому варианту отдать предпочтение?
Ubuntu 18.04 LTS | Intel® Core™ i5-6500 CPU @ 3.20GHz × 4 | GeForce GTX 1060 6GB/PCIe/SSE2 | RAM 16Gb | и ни в коем случае не пользуйтесь услугами uadomen.com

Оффлайн yorik1984

  • Заслуженный пользователь
  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 1592
  • Кто не хочет, ищет причины
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#1 : 21 Апреля 2013, 20:25:45 »
Есть ещё вариант с подключением репозитория и установить редактор оттуда.
Я себе ставил именно так! Через Ubuntu твик репозиторий подключал. Много попробовал редакторов, но этот лучшее из того что я видел. И красиво! И Практично!

Оффлайн Haron Prime

  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 11312
  • Нетолерантный социопат
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#2 : 21 Апреля 2013, 20:32:40 »
пробовал оба варианта
сначала запустил из тарбола, попользовался, понравилось, подключил PPA

Оффлайн slo_nik

  • Автор темы
  • Активист
  • *
  • Сообщений: 489
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#3 : 21 Апреля 2013, 20:55:33 »
пробовал оба варианта
сначала запустил из тарбола, попользовался, понравилось, подключил PPA
Извините, но не понял слова "тарбол" )))

И если, в конечном счёте, мне понравиться сей редактор, то куда его переместить на постоянное жительство в системе, в /opt?
Ubuntu 18.04 LTS | Intel® Core™ i5-6500 CPU @ 3.20GHz × 4 | GeForce GTX 1060 6GB/PCIe/SSE2 | RAM 16Gb | и ни в коем случае не пользуйтесь услугами uadomen.com

Оффлайн Haron Prime

  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 11312
  • Нетолерантный социопат
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#4 : 21 Апреля 2013, 20:57:33 »
slo_nik,
тарбол - *.tar.*  ))))
архив в формате tar

Оффлайн yorik1984

  • Заслуженный пользователь
  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 1592
  • Кто не хочет, ищет причины
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#5 : 21 Апреля 2013, 21:00:32 »
И если, в конечном счёте, мне понравиться сей редактор, то куда его переместить на постоянное жительство в системе, в /opt?
У меня в жомашнем каталоге есть каталог bin
туда и помещаю. Если переустанавливать систему, то можно забыть про /opt

Оффлайн slo_nik

  • Автор темы
  • Активист
  • *
  • Сообщений: 489
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#6 : 21 Апреля 2013, 21:15:23 »
slo_nik,
тарбол - *.tar.*  ))))
архив в формате tar
Благодарствую, буду занать)))
И если, в конечном счёте, мне понравиться сей редактор, то куда его переместить на постоянное жительство в системе, в /opt?
У меня в жомашнем каталоге есть каталог bin
туда и помещаю. Если переустанавливать систему, то можно забыть про /opt
Есть уже такая директория, хранятся там пару скриптов. Но вот небольшая проблемка возникла. Переместил в эту директорию папку с редактором, всё запускается. Закрепил ярлык программы на панели, для удобства, но при клике по ярлыку редактор отказывается запускаться, только с sublime_text стартует.
Как исправить ситуацию?
Ubuntu 18.04 LTS | Intel® Core™ i5-6500 CPU @ 3.20GHz × 4 | GeForce GTX 1060 6GB/PCIe/SSE2 | RAM 16Gb | и ни в коем случае не пользуйтесь услугами uadomen.com

Оффлайн Haron Prime

  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 11312
  • Нетолерантный социопат
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#7 : 21 Апреля 2013, 21:28:50 »
sudo ln -s ~/location_subj/sublime-text-2 /usr/bin
sudo touch /usr/share/applications/sublime-text-2.desktop
вставить
#!/usr/bin/env xdg-open

[Desktop Entry]
Name=Sublime Text 2
GenericName=Text Editor
Comment=Sophisticated text editor for code, html and prose
Exec=/usr/bin/sublime-text-2 %F
Terminal=false
Type=Application
MimeType=text/plain;text/x-chdr;text/x-csrc;text/x-c++hdr;text/x-c++src;text/x-java;text/x-dsrc;text/x-pascal;text/x-perl;text/x-python;application/x-php;application/x-httpd-php3;application/x-httpd-php4;application/x-httpd-php5;application/xml;text/html;text/css;text/x-sql;text/x-diff;x-directory/normal;inode/directory;
Icon=sublime-text-2
Categories=TextEditor;Development;Utility;
Name[en_US]=Sublime Text 2
X-Ayatana-Desktop-Shortcuts=NewWindow;

[NewWindow Shortcut Group]
Name=Open a New Window
Exec=/usr/bin/sublime-text-2 --new-window
TargetEnvironment=Unity
сохранить, вытащить на панель юнити

Оффлайн Haron Prime

  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 11312
  • Нетолерантный социопат
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#8 : 21 Апреля 2013, 21:31:21 »
P.S> у меня стоит дев-версия сабжа - sublime-text-2
потому писал как для себя
пути к исполнительному файлу и его название, имхо, подправить не трудно

Оффлайн slo_nik

  • Автор темы
  • Активист
  • *
  • Сообщений: 489
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#9 : 21 Апреля 2013, 21:55:10 »
P.S> у меня стоит дев-версия сабжа - sublime-text-2
потому писал как для себя
пути к исполнительному файлу и его название, имхо, подправить не трудно
Вот как раз по этой теме вопрос созрел
Директорию с редактором переместил в ~/.bin/Sublime Text 2
получается, что путь должен быть

sudo ln -s ~/.bin/Sublime Text 2/sublime_text /usr/bin
создаю символическую ссылку на исполняемый файл, а не на директорию?
Ubuntu 18.04 LTS | Intel® Core™ i5-6500 CPU @ 3.20GHz × 4 | GeForce GTX 1060 6GB/PCIe/SSE2 | RAM 16Gb | и ни в коем случае не пользуйтесь услугами uadomen.com

Оффлайн Haron Prime

  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 11312
  • Нетолерантный социопат
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#10 : 21 Апреля 2013, 21:56:06 »
ну конечно!

PS
sudo ln -s ~/.bin/Sublime Text 2/sublime_text /usr/bin  -  не прокатит из за пробелов в пути к исполняемому файлу!
их нужно экранировать \
sudo ln -s ~/.bin/Sublime\ Text\ 2/sublime_text /usr/bin
да и вообще, создавать файлы/каталоги с пробелами в названии - дурной тон
« Последнее редактирование: 21 Апреля 2013, 21:59:34 от Haron Prime »

Оффлайн slo_nik

  • Автор темы
  • Активист
  • *
  • Сообщений: 489
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#11 : 21 Апреля 2013, 22:02:00 »
ну конечно!
Извините, но пока я очень плохо ориентируюсь в Ubuntu...)))

Благодарю, буду пробовать


Пользователь решил продолжить мысль 21 Апреля 2013, 22:04:39:
PS
sudo ln -s ~/.bin/Sublime Text 2/sublime_text /usr/bin  -  не прокатит из за пробелов в пути к исполняемому файлу!
их нужно экранировать \
sudo ln -s ~/.bin/Sublime\ Text\ 2/sublime_text /usr/bin
да и вообще, создавать файлы/каталоги с пробелами в названии - дурной тон
Спасибо, про экранирование пробелов знаю, уже успел запомнить)))
Но вот имя директории с редактором обязательно подправлю, спасибо
« Последнее редактирование: 21 Апреля 2013, 22:04:39 от slo_nik »
Ubuntu 18.04 LTS | Intel® Core™ i5-6500 CPU @ 3.20GHz × 4 | GeForce GTX 1060 6GB/PCIe/SSE2 | RAM 16Gb | и ни в коем случае не пользуйтесь услугами uadomen.com

Оффлайн yorik1984

  • Заслуженный пользователь
  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 1592
  • Кто не хочет, ищет причины
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#12 : 21 Апреля 2013, 22:09:36 »
и точку перед bin незачем ставить, если ее не надо прятать от глаз по умолчанию.

Оффлайн slo_nik

  • Автор темы
  • Активист
  • *
  • Сообщений: 489
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#13 : 21 Апреля 2013, 22:12:11 »
специально поставил, чтобы глаза не мозолила, заглядывать часто в директорию незачем.

Пользователь решил продолжить мысль 21 Апреля 2013, 22:17:25:
И ещё такой вопрос.
Как посоветовал yorik1984, оставил программу в домашнем каталоге, но файл desktop создаётся в служебных каталогах.
Получается, что если переустановить систему, то сам редактор останется, а вот файл ссылки и desktop удалятся, надо будет создавать заново.
Можно ли это обойти?
« Последнее редактирование: 21 Апреля 2013, 22:17:25 от slo_nik »
Ubuntu 18.04 LTS | Intel® Core™ i5-6500 CPU @ 3.20GHz × 4 | GeForce GTX 1060 6GB/PCIe/SSE2 | RAM 16Gb | и ни в коем случае не пользуйтесь услугами uadomen.com

Оффлайн yorik1984

  • Заслуженный пользователь
  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 1592
  • Кто не хочет, ищет причины
    • Просмотр профиля
Re: Sublime Text 2, установка
« Ответ #14 : 21 Апреля 2013, 22:25:13 »
Да. Так и будет.
Тут проще редактировать переменную $PATH. Прописать в ней путь к каталогу с вашими исполняемыми файлами. А вот это уже с переустановкой системы будет потом работать. так как переменные окружения прописываться в файле .profile

 

Страница сгенерирована за 0.018 секунд. Запросов: 21.